CenturyTel, Inc., also known as CenturyLink, is a prominent telecommunications provider headquartered in the United States. With a strong presence in the Tri-State markets, the company has been a key player in the industry since its founding in 1930. CenturyTel focuses on delivering a wide range of services, including voice, data, and broadband solutions, catering to both residential and business customers.
